Ingredients

2 fl oz (no ice)

Gin

1/4 fl oz (no ice)

crème de violette

3/4 fl oz

Lemon Juice

2 ml

Lavender Simple Syrup

2 fl oz

Water

1/4 cup

Ice

Directions

1

Add gin, crème de violette, lemon juice, lavender syrup, and water to the magic bullet® Blending Cup and blend for 30 seconds to one minute until fully combined.

2

Add ice to the magic bullet® mixture and pulse until your drink reaches its desired consistency.

3

Pour into your glass of choice.

4

Garnish with lemon wheel and lavender sprigs.

5

Enjoy!
